    what about mung beans in a jar? Can that be done?

    • @LovinglyPlantbased
      @LovinglyPlantbased  3 месяца назад

      Yes, mung bean sprouts can be grown in and on almost anything! Just bear in mind that mung like being weighted down and keeping them in darkness makes them taste sweeter.
      If however you just want to sprout them for a couple of days so they have a little tail, then jars are fine. I used jars for mung sprouts for decades 👍🏻
